We present to you the Particle Photon, a worthy successor to the Particle Core.
Photon alone with connector allows you to bring your IoT (Internet of Things) developments to life. The Photon offers everything you need to realize a connected project. Spark Labs Inc made the Photon using a powerful ARM Cortex M3 microcontroller clocked at 120Mhz, accompanied by WiFi support supported by Broadcom, all in a mini module called PØ (P-Zero) no more as big as a nail. The Photon is delivered alone with the connectors (pinHeader) welded.
Note that there is also another version of this product which is the photon kit (kit including the "photon", a small breadboard, a USB cable and some small components allowing you to get started directly in the discovery of the Internet of Things ).
Prototyping is really easy since the Photon fits directly into a breadboard (or prototyping plate). You can also connect it directly to a board with 2x12-pin connectors (for example, this product or the relay module). The Photon isn't only powerful but also easy to use. Its small form factor makes it an ideal component for IoT projects needing connectivity in the Cloud.
To help the Maker get started quickly, the board has added an excellent and robust 3.3V DC SMPS type power supply. Power, P0, RF and user interface all fit on this tiny board.
The Photon includes access to the Particle Cloud and free cloud services. The Particle Cloud has great features to realize connected objects/projects, with, among other things:
- Firmware update/programming via WiFi connection,
- An easy-to-use REST programming interface,
- An online development environment (called build) and an IDE development environment that you can install on your computer.

Features
- Particle Wi-Fi PØ Wi-Fi module
- Broadcom BCM43362 WiFi chip
- WiFi 802.11b/g/n
- STM32F205 120Mhz ARM Cortex M3
- 1MB flash, 128KB RAM
- An RGB LED (on the board) indicating the status of the Core (external control allowed)
- 18 GPIO signals - various features and advanced peripherals
- Open-Source design
- Real-time operating systems (FreeRTOS)
- Access point configuration via software (Soft AP setup)
- FCC, CE and IC certified
- FCC ID: 2AEMI-PHOTON (fccid.io)

Connect an external antenna
You will need the following elements to connect a 2.4GHz external WiFI antenna to this product:
- a µFL to SMA adapter
- an SMA - RP-SMA adapter (to go to the RP-SMA industry standard)
- 2.4Ghz antenna (WiFi) - Dipole, 2bBi gain, 50 Ohms impedance, RP-SMA connector.
